The debt snowball method is a debt-reduction strategy where you pay off debt in order of smallest to largest, gaining momentum as you knock out each remaining balance.When the smallest debt is paid in full, you roll the minimum payment you were making on that debt into the next-smallest debt payment.

WebThe snowball method is criticized by some who believe you should focus on paying off debts with the highest interest rates first (this is known as the debt avalanche method). WebOct 11, 2024 · Baby Step 1 – $1,000 to start an Emergency Fund. Baby Step 2 – Pay off all debt using the Debt Snowball. Baby Step 3 – 3 to 6 months of expenses in savings. Baby Step 4 – Invest 15% of household income into Roth IRAs and pre-tax retirement. Baby Step 5 – College funding for children.
